  21. The Ravens went with a ground-and-pound approach on a windy day and a muddy field, and the offense finished with a season-best 174 rushing yards. The improved performance was a big step forward in a year where running the ball has been a challenge, and the Ravens now hope to build off that effort against the New York Jets. But that won’t be an easy task against the NFL’s top-ranked run defense, and Jets Head Coach Rex Ryan even dared the Ravens to try to run the ball on his team. “We’re No. 1 in the league versus the run – that’s no surprise,” Ryan said. “We’re No. 1 in the league in rushing average, too, so come in and run it at us if you want.” New York’s run defense is led by an impressive front seven, headlined by defensive linemen Muhammad Wilkerson, Damon Harrison and Sheldon Richardson. They have dominated offensive lines all season and held opponents to just 73.2 rushing yards per game. http://www.baltimoreravens.com/news/article-1/Rex-Ryan-Dares-Ravens-To-Run-Against-His-Defense/70c04785-d51d-47a0-bba1-d5573c836b73
